The difference in cost and value do add to the confusion, however the
ability to compare different projects in person-hours would be of
interest and perhaps even valuable in itself. To be able to say more
person-hours have been spent creating program suite X then building the
Sydney Harbour Bridge may allow some understanding of the effort
required to create good/bad software, and allow comparisons of
efficiency between (teams of) programmers, and programming languages.

All up, I'm not yet ready to abandon the question as useless.
